Freedom: Keep personal beliefs under control

 

 
 
 

Dear Editor,

We all exchange a small amount of freedom for the security of living within an organized society.

Power is given to government for the sole purpose of restricting behaviour that injures others against their will. That limited government is the symbol of a free society.

Extending the powers of government beyond that, into matters of personal choice, crosses the line between freedom and tyranny.

It is up to us, as voters, to decide how much government involvement we want in our lives, but when making that decision, it is important to keep in mind that, if you allow yourself to impose your beliefs on others, through the use of government, you are opening the door for others to impose their beliefs on you.
